
网络编程
ah_hzy
光而不耀,静水流深。
展开
-
(八)使用数据报进行广播通信
使用数据报进行广播通信 DatagramSocket只允许数据报发往一个目的地址MulticastSocket将数据报以广播方式发送到该端口的所有客户MulticastSocket用在客户端,监听服务器广播来的数据客户方程序:public class MulticastClient { public static void main(String[] args)t...原创 2019-07-09 16:34:51 · 418 阅读 · 0 评论 -
(九)网络聊天程序
demo:带界面的聊天程序public class ChatFrame extends JFrame implements ActionListener { JTextField tf; JTextArea ta; JScrollPane sp; JButton send; JPanel P; int port; String s=""...原创 2019-07-09 19:51:22 · 234 阅读 · 2 评论 -
(一)URL对象
目录 网络基础知识 通过URL读取www信息 构造URL对象 获取URL对象属性 网络基础知识 Ipv4地址(32位,4个字节)Ipv6地址(128位,16个字节)主机名(hostname)如:www.tsinghua.edu.cn端口号(postnumber)如:80,21,23,1-1024为保留...原创 2019-07-04 20:40:40 · 720 阅读 · 0 评论 -
(二)URLConnection对象
目录 URLConnection对象含义 URLConnection与URL的区别 使用URLConnection通信的一般步骤 通过URLConnection读写WWW资源 URLConnection含义 一个URLConnection对象代表一个URL资源与Java程序的通讯连接,可以通过它对这个URL资源读或写 URLConnection与U...原创 2019-07-04 20:45:02 · 421 阅读 · 0 评论 -
(三)Get请求与Post请求
发送Get请求 目录 发送Get请求 发送POST请求 public static String sendGet(String url,String param){ String result="";BufferReader in=null;try{ String urlNameString=url+"?"+param; URL realUrl=ne...原创 2019-07-05 13:38:00 · 371 阅读 · 0 评论 -
(四)Socket通信原理
目录TCP传输协议socket通讯 TCP传输协议 面向连接的能够提供可靠地流式数据的传输协议,类似于打电话的过程.URL,URLConnection,Socket,ServerSocket等类都使用TCP协议进行网络通讯. socket通讯 网络上的两个程序通过一个双向的通讯连接实现数据的交换,这个双向链路的一端称为一个socket.socket...原创 2019-07-05 13:58:26 · 191 阅读 · 0 评论 -
(五)Sccket通信实现
创建socket 创建socket Socket();Socket(InetAddress address,int port);Socket(String host,int port);Socket(InetAddress host,int port,InetAddress localAddr,int localPort);Socket(String host,int...原创 2019-07-05 15:00:54 · 252 阅读 · 0 评论 -
(六)Socket多客户端通信实现
目录 多客户端通信机制 多客户端通信实现 多客户端通信机制 多客户端通信实现 客户端程序:public class MultiTalkClient{ int num;public static void main(String args[]){ try{Socket socket=new Socket("127.0.0.1",4700);//键盘输...原创 2019-07-05 19:15:47 · 273 阅读 · 0 评论 -
(七)数据报通信
目录 数据报通信 TCP和UDP的建立时间 构造UDP的通信 收数据报 发数据报 UDP:非面向连接的提供不可靠的数据包式的数据传输的协议.类似于从邮局发送信件的过程DatagramPacket,DatagramSocket,MulticastSocket等类使用UDP协议进行网络通讯TCP:面向连接的能够提供可靠地流式数据的传输协议,类似于打电话的过程....原创 2019-07-09 15:52:36 · 328 阅读 · 0 评论